Smart Heating Installation Decisions

Before investing in a new heating system, consider these crucial factors:

• Calculate the correct size based on your home’s square footage and layout
• Evaluate energy efficiency ratings
• Consider zoning options for multi-level homes
• Review warranty coverage details

Preventive Maintenance Tips

Regular maintenance helps avoid costly repairs and extends system life:

• Schedule professional inspections twice yearly
• Replace air filters monthly
• Keep vents and registers clear
• Monitor unusual sounds or odors
• Check thermostat accuracy regularly

Signs You Need Furnace Replacement

Watch for these warning signals:

• System age exceeding 15 years
• Frequent repair needs
• Rising energy bills
• Uneven heating throughout your home
• Strange noises or persistent odors

Emergency Service Preparation

Keep these tips handy for heating emergencies:

• Know your system’s model number
• Document recent maintenance dates
• Keep vents clear of furniture
• Have backup heating options ready
• Save emergency service numbers
